Transaction 8aaa1b609fb6b988490c3a091d125d63ed481a656b1699bf1ddd0a72b808e488
1 Input
1 Output
-
8aaa1b609fb6b988490c3a091d125d63ed481a656b1699bf1ddd0a72b808e488:0
- value
- 62223488
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bf2a2afc8b202ca89c138e430a9e622c4455149 OP_EQUALVERIFY OP_CHECKSIG
- address
- 151Nirnmtareb1dxwr5WTvqop9UACF51oh